Step 1: Understand What DevOps Really Means

DevOps is about speed, automation, and reliability.
Core DevOps goals:
  • Faster software delivery
  • Better collaboration
  • Stable production systems
Why does it work?
Automation reduces errors and saves time.

Step 2: Learn Linux & Basic Scripting First

DevOps starts with strong system basics.
Focus on:
  • Linux commands
  • File permissions & processes
  • Basic Bash scripting
Why does it work?
Most DevOps tools run on Linux servers.

Step 3: Version Control with Git & GitHub

Every DevOps workflow starts with code.
You must know:
  • Git basics (clone, commit, push)
  • Branching & merging
  • GitHub repositories
Why does it work?
CI/CD pipelines depend on version control.

Step 4: Jenkins for CI/CD Automation

Jenkins is a core DevOps tool.
Learn Jenkins basics:
  • Build jobs & pipelines.
  • Jenkinsfile (pipeline as code)
  • Integrate Git and build
Why does it work?
Jenkins automates testing and deployment.

Step 5: Containerization with Docker

Modern apps run inside containers.
Key Docker skills:
  • Docker images & containers
  • Dockerfile basics
  • Push images to the registry.
Why does it work?
Containers make apps portable and scalable.

Step 6: Kubernetes for Container Orchestration

Kubernetes is mandatory for DevOps roles.
Core concepts:
  • Pods, services, deployments
  • Scaling & self-healing
  • ConfigMaps & Secrets
Why does it work?
Kubernetes manages containers at scale.

Step 7: Cloud & Monitoring Basics

DevOps is incomplete without cloud and monitoring.
Learn the basics of:
  • Cloud platforms (AWS / Azure / GCP)
  • Monitoring & logging tools
  • Alerts and performance tracking
Why does it work?
Production systems need visibility and control.

Step 8: Build Real DevOps Projects

Projects make you job-ready.
Project ideas:
  • CI/CD pipeline using Jenkins + Docker
  • Deploy the app on Kubernetes.
  • Auto-deploy from GitHub
Why does it work?
Hands-on experience wins interviews.
